We are seeking a full time Primary Care Physician at Luke AFB in Glendale, AZ.
CORE Duties:
- Perform a full range of physician services in accordance with privileges granted by the MTF.
- Technically direct, perform, or assist in the instruction of other health care professionals within the scope of the clinical privileges or responsibilities.
- Examine, diagnose, treat or prescribe courses of treatment within the scope of training, experience, and privileges.
- Provide preventive and health maintenance care, including annual physicals, positive health behaviors, and self-care skills through education and counseling.
- Order diagnostic tests as applicable as well as request consultation or referral with appropriate physicians, clinics, or other health resources as indicated.
- Technically proficient in clinically directing and teaching other medical staff, providing educational lectures and participating in the provision of in-service training to clinic staff members. Such direction and interaction will adhere to Government and professional clinical standards and accepted clinical protocols. Completes medical record documentation and coding and designated tracking logs and data reporting as required by local MTF/AF/DoD instructions, policies and guidance. Completes all required training in accordance with DoD, DHA and Medical Group policies/instructions and guidelines.

Requirements
Minimum Qualifications:
- Degree: M.D. or DO
- Education: Possesses a Doctor of Medicine degree or a Doctor of Osteopathy degree from from a medical school in the United States, Canada, or approved by the Liaison Committee on Medical Education of the American Medical Association (AMA), graduation from a college of osteopathy approved by the American Osteopathic Association (AOA), or graduation from a medical school with evidence of Educational Commission for Foreign Medical Graduates (ECFMG) certification.
- Experience: As required to meet clinical competency requirements specified in the credentialing instructions.
- Internship/Residency: Successful completion of an internship and accredited residency approved by the Accreditation Council for Graduate Medical Education (ACGME).
- Licensure: Current, unrestricted medical license from any state
- Board Certification: Board eligibility is required. Board certification if preferred. Board certified by the American Board of Internal Medicine, the American Board of Family Practice, the American Osteopathic Board of Internal Medicine, or the American Osteopathic Board of Family Physicians.
- Life Support Certification: Possess current BLS certification
- Security: Must possess ability to pass a Government background check/security clearance.
